\title{Hoare Logic for Parallel Programs}
|
|
18 |
\author{Leonor Prensa Nieto}
|
|
19 |
\maketitle
|
|
20 |
|
13099
|
21 |
\begin{abstract}\noindent
|
|
22 |
In the following theories a formalization of the Owicki-Gries and
|
|
23 |
the rely-guarantee methods is presented. These methods are widely
|
|
24 |
used for correctness proofs of parallel imperative programs with
|
|
25 |
shared variables. We define syntax, semantics and proof rules in
|
|
26 |
Isabelle/HOL. The proof rules also provide for programs
|
|
27 |
parameterized in the number of parallel components. Their
|
|
28 |
correctness w.r.t.\ the semantics is proven. Completeness proofs
|
|
29 |
for both methods are extended to the new case of parameterized
|
|
30 |
programs. (These proofs have not been formalized in Isabelle. They
|
|
31 |
can be found in~\cite{Prensa-PhD}.) Using this formalizations we
|
|
32 |
verify several non-trivial examples for parameterized and
|
|
33 |
non-parameterized programs. For the automatic generation of
|
|
34 |
verification conditions with the Owicki-Gries method we define a
|
|
35 |
tactic based on the proof rules. The most involved examples are the
|
|
36 |
verification of two garbage-collection algorithms, the second one
|
|
37 |
parameterized in the number of mutators.
